About the role:

To provide high-quality financial planning and analysis to the executive leadership and operational teams to drive performance, understanding and growth.

Financial performance:

Analyse the monthly financial results prepared by the accounting team to highlight and comment on key variances to budget or forecast, if applicable and related action plans.
Act as a Business Partner for budget holders and Senior Leaders, guiding them on commercial matters and promoting financial understanding.
Work with and support stakeholders to track and analysis their Corporate Overhead costs, building raptor and holding them accountable for budget delivery.
Work closely with the Business Intelligence team to create and distribute financial results and scorecards via systems and automation.
Ensure financial KPIs are appropriate for the division and provide clear and accurate reporting of these KPIs, highlighting key trends to help decision making.
Effectively and objectively communicate performance to the business, challenging budget holders and maintaining accountability in the business.
Lead the financial appraisal of ad-hoc projects and undertake analysis as requested by the Head of FP&A, Operations Leads, FD etc.
Budget and Forecast:

Lead the relevant operating cost center budgeting process across all Corporate Overheads, ensuring Group alignment on timelines and relevant analysis is adhered to.
Maintain a budget and forecast financial model to ensure consistency of data and process across all areas, including inclusion of appropriate KPIs.
Support the Head of FP&A and the Business Intelligence team to implement automated and system driven budgeting and modelling tools.

Experience, Skills & Qualifications:

Essential

Studying towards a relevant accounting qualification (CIMA / ACCA / ACA etc.)
Unqualified candidates with significant relevant experience would be considered.
A relevant Degree (Accounting / Finance / Maths etc.)
Proven ability to influence financial outcomes and work closely with operational managers.
Strong interpersonal and communication skills. Ability to communicate and build relationships with people at different levels.
Advanced Excel skills critical – data manipulation (including extraction from financial ledgers), analytical and presentation skills at a level suitable for Executive review.
Ability to present complex data and analysis in a high impact visual manner to senior stakeholders, drawing out the key messages and findings.
Relevant management accounting experience.
Working knowledge of MS Office including Microsoft PowerPoint.
Experience of Access Dimensions would be advantageous, though not essential.

About the Group

Outcomes First Group is the leading provider of specialist education in the UK. We exist to give neurodivergent children and young people access to a great education that caters to their specific needs, abilities and aspirations.

There are three brands in our Outcomes First family: Acorn Education, Options Autism and Momenta Connect. Together, we educate, care for and support children, young people, and adults across the UK, empowering them to be happy and make their way in the world.
